How it works
Drop in your entries. The platform does the rest.
Every IEEPA refund starts as a stack of CBP Form 7501s that has to be read, validated, and filed through the CAPE portal. Corvant automates that spine end to end.
01 · Read
AI vision reads every 7501.
Entry numbers, HTS lines, country of origin, entered value, and liquidation date — pulled the moment you upload. No manual keying; hundreds of entries in the time it takes to drag them in.
02 · Route
Every entry sorts into its lane.
CAPE for what a broker can file directly, counsel for contested or multi-country exposure, factoring for verified receivables — validated against the portal's exact format first, so nothing bounces.
03 · Reconcile
Never file the same entry twice.
When CBP results come back, Corvant subtracts what's already filed from what's still owed — so the next phase of work targets only the remainder. Live today, not coming soon.

The hybrid reality
Most claims are mixed.
A single importer often has a CAPE-eligible portion a broker files fast, a contested portion that needs counsel, and a factoring option layered on for liquidity. Corvant keeps importer, broker, counsel, factor, and CPA on the same record and the same timeline — surfacing every viable pathway instead of forcing one channel.
Clean, in-window entries a broker or importer files directly through the portal.
Contested classifications and multi-country exposure routed to vetted recovery counsel.
Verified receivables an importer can borrow against while CBP pays out.
